Dricus Du Plessis vs. Sean Strickland: A Clash for Middleweight Gold
The main event of UFC 297 featured a showdown for the coveted UFC middleweight title between Dricus Du Plessis and Sean Strickland. From the opening bell, it was clear that this would be a battle for the ages, with both fighters leaving everything they had inside the octagon.
Du Plessis, known for his explosive striking and relentless aggression, came out swinging, looking to impose his will on Strickland early in the fight. However, Strickland, a seasoned veteran with an iron will, refused to back down, weathering Du Plessis’ storm and delivering punishing blows of his own.
As the fight went the distance, both fighters showcased their skill and determination, leaving the judges with a difficult decision to make. In the end, it was Du Plessis who emerged victorious, securing the UFC middleweight title via a hard-fought split decision. His victory was a testament to his resilience, grit, and unwavering desire to be the best.

Raquel Pennington vs. Mayra Bueno Silva: A Battle for Bantamweight Supremacy
In the co-main event of the evening, Raquel Pennington faced off against Mayra Bueno Silva in a clash for the UFC bantamweight title. From the outset, Pennington showcased her superior striking and grappling skills, dictating the pace of the fight and keeping Bueno Silva on the defensive.
Despite Bueno Silva’s best efforts to mount a comeback, Pennington’s dominance proved too much to overcome. With precise striking and relentless pressure, Pennington controlled the majority of the fight, earning a unanimous decision victory and capturing the UFC bantamweight title in the process.
Movsar Evloev vs. Arnold Allen: A Featherweight Showdown
The third title fight of the evening featured a featherweight showdown between Movsar Evloev and Arnold Allen. In a closely contested bout, both fighters showcased their skills and determination, trading blows and grappling for control throughout the fight.
Ultimately, it was Evloev who emerged victorious, outpointing Allen in a hard-fought battle to secure the victory. His win was a testament to his skill, heart, and unwavering determination to come out on top.
